Try this. In a tall glass filled 3/4 with ice, add.... Equal amounts of pineapple and coconut rum until you are about 1" from the rim. Add OJ almost to the top and then a splash of Grenadine. These are known as HarbourBlasters in Little Harbour, Abacos, Bahamas. The last time that I was there, the record was 10. The best of our crew managed 6. LOL Start with the same glass and ice, add...... Pineapple rum and vodka to the same preportions. Top off the glass with pineapple juice. These are known as Baby Barracudas. They are from Elbo Cay, Abacos, Bahamas. There are some stories behind them that will never be told here!
